Register
Log In
0
Home
Services
Countries
Egypt
Algeria
Morocco
Saudia Arabia
UAE
Search Companies
Browse the Directory
AFIANA
AFIANB
AFIANC
AFIAND
AFIANE
AFIANF
AFIANG
AFIANH
AFIANI
AFIANJ
AFIANK
AFIANL
AFIANM
AFIANN
AFIANO
AFIANP
AFIANQ
AFIANR
AFIANS
AFIANT
AFIANU
AFIANV
AFIANW
AFIANX
AFIANY
AFIANZ
AFIAN ELECTROMECHANICAL EQUIPMENT INSTALLATION L.L.C
Total records:
1
1